Core Impression
Baldur's Gate 3 has received overwhelmingly positive reviews from the player base, being regarded as a genre-defining masterpiece. Among the 200 comments analyzed, as many as 58% of players expressed extreme love for the game, while another 28% indicated they liked it, with the combined positive reviews accounting for 86%.
Player Favorites
The top three most praised aspects by players are narrative depth, role-playing freedom, and replay value. First, the game's story received unanimous acclaim, with one player stating, "The story is rich and flushed out. Adventure to be had no matter your choices." Second, the character system offers exceptional freedom and depth, with players praising its rich character creation and interaction options. Finally, the high replay value is another highlight, with players noting, "Endless replay ability," believing that the vast content and diverse choice paths ensure the game's lasting appeal.
Player Dissatisfactions
Player criticisms mainly focus on three areas. The primary issue is technical glitches, with some players experiencing frequent crashes, such as "Keeps crashing. I've restarted my computer, verified all files, and tried reloading older save files." Next is the decline in content quality in Act 3, with comments pointing out "Falls off in ACT 3 hard..." Additionally, a minority of players expressed dissatisfaction with specific designs (such as character relationship options), believing "Relationship options are so woke, it's not even worth starting one if..."
Risk Warning
Currently, the sentiment risk level is low. Despite technical issues and controversy over Act 3 content, negative (disliked 5%) and extremely negative (hated 3%) reviews combined account for only 8%, with no trend of large-scale complaints or significant rating drops. Mixed reviews also account for only 6%. The game's core strengths (story, character system, replayability) have received high and stable praise, and the overall reputation is extremely solid.
